What implications do judicial records have in Costa Rica for obtaining employment?
Judicial records in Costa Rica can have significant implications when seeking employment. Many employers request background checks on candidates to assess their suitability and safety in the workplace. Depending on the nature of the crime and the position for which you are applying, a criminal conviction on your record may influence your hiring decision. However, the law states that in certain cases a person cannot be discriminated against based solely on their criminal record, unless there is a direct relationship between the crime and the responsibilities of the position.
What is the current situation of access to health care services in community areas of people with intellectual disabilities in Brazil?
Access to health care services in community areas of people with intellectual disabilities in Brazil faces challenges due to the lack of specialized resources and the need for support services adapted to the specific needs of these people. The government has implemented programs and policies to improve access to health care services in these communities, including training health professionals in inclusive approaches and promoting the participation of people with intellectual disabilities and their families in planning and making health-related decisions. It seeks to guarantee equitable access to quality health services, promoting the health and well-being of people with intellectual disabilities.
